The National Monuments Service's description
In gently undulating pasture on top of a natural gravel mound. The remains of a motte are defined by a steep scarp (Wth 4m; H 3m) from W-SE, with most of the S and central area (dims. c. 32m N-S; c. 30m E-W) quarried. There is a disturbed, uneven area in the NW sector, a plateau area (c. 26m NW-SE; 18m NE-SW) in the NE sector and short section of bank (Wth 8m; H 1.5m) at the SE. The mound not depicted on the 1st (1840) ed. OS 6-inch map but is depicted on the later (1904) ed. OS 6-inch map as an oval mound (dims. c. 52m N-S; c. 35m E-W) with a quarry immediately to the S, with a trackway leading to the quarry. According to Flynn (1913, 13), who published a plan and section of the monument, the range of gravel hills NW-N-NE of Tipperary town terminate 'in the little hill of Garranacanty whose extremity is defended at the summit by a well defined fosse and rampart, whilst the summit itself affords evidences of attempts to construct a mound or enclosure'.
